I came to Chennai in the year 1993 and moved into my apartment at one end of the famous Elliots Beach. Those days Elliots beach was a nice place and there were no hawkers in the beach. Going for a walk at night in the baech used to be a very pleasant experience.
These days I avoid going to the beach, especially in the evenings even on weekdays since it is very crowded. On Sundays and holidays, literally there is chaos in the beach since it is overcrowded with cars which have no place to park. Visitors to Elliots beach have now started parking their vechicles in all the side roads thereby creating a problem to the residents living there.
On Monday morning, you will find the beach littered with leftovers of food, platic plates, bottles, ice cream cups etc. I wonder when we as a nation are going to become more aware of these aspects of life?
